Development of a dual fluorescent reporter system in <i>Clostridioides difficile</i> reveals a division of labor between virulence and transmission gene expression

2022-03-04

Abstract excerpt

<h4>ABSTRACT</h4> The bacterial pathogen Clostridioides difficile causes gastroenteritis through its production of toxins and transmits disease through its production of resistant spores. Toxin and spore production are energy-expensive processes that are regulated by multiple transcription factors in response to many nutritional inputs.
